University West hosted the kick off event of the STARS EU alliance

From December 4th to 6th, approximately 100 individuals from the STARS EU alliance's nine partner universities gathered at University West in Trollhättan, Sweden. This assembly marked the commencement of activities for the eight work packages constituting the European University Alliance project, which is funded by the European Commission.

Presentation of the CEPIS project to a delegation of European journalists

At its meeting on 26 October 2023, the Selection Committee of the Operational Programme Just Transition Fund recommended the CEPIS project (Centre for Entrepreneurship, Professional and International Studies) for funding. This effectively completes the evaluation and approval process, which will be finalized by the end of the year with the issuance of the grant decision.

If we want to harvest, we must plant!

The invisible seeds were planted a long time ago when the Silesian University started the process of becoming a European University. The intensive work of several years has paid off and this June we received great news: STARS EU, an alliance of nine European universities of which our university is a member, was awarded a four-year grant totalling EUR 12.4 million in the Erasmus+ "European Universities" call! The work in the international teams is now in progress. The symbolism of collective care leading to common growth in many areas has been demonstrated in the current autumn days by planting tulip bulbs that will bloom in the spring, in the formation of the STARS EU alliance logo.
